도메인을 웹호스팅에 연결하는 것은 웹사이트를 운영하기 위해 반드시 필요한 과정이에요. 도메인을 연결하면 사용자가 특정 URL을 입력했을 때, 해당 웹사이트로 연결되도록 설정할 수 있습니다. 이 과정은 생각보다 간단하지만, 처음 접하는 분들에게는 조금 생소할 수도 있습니다. 아래에서 도메인을 웹호스팅에 연결하는 방법을 구체적으로 설명드릴게요.
1. 도메인과 웹호스팅의 관계 이해하기
도메인과 웹호스팅은 각각 인터넷에서 웹사이트를 운영하는 데 중요한 역할을 합니다. 도메인은 사용자가 웹사이트를 쉽게 찾을 수 있는 주소 역할을 하고, 웹호스팅은 해당 웹사이트의 콘텐츠와 데이터를 저장하는 공간이에요.
도메인의 역할
- 도메인은 웹사이트의 주소로, 사용자가 웹브라우저에서 입력하는 URL이에요.
- 예를 들어,
www.example.com같은 도메인이 이에 해당됩니다. - 사람이 기억하기 쉬운 방식으로 IP 주소를 대신합니다.
웹호스팅의 역할
- 웹호스팅은 웹사이트 데이터를 저장하는 서버 공간입니다.
- 모든 텍스트, 이미지, 동영상 파일 등이 여기에 저장돼요.
- 사용자가 도메인을 입력하면, 이 호스팅 서버에서 데이터를 가져와 웹사이트가 표시됩니다.
2. 도메인 연결을 위한 준비
웹호스팅과 도메인을 연결하려면 몇 가지 사전 준비가 필요합니다. 다음 과정을 따라 진행하세요.
웹호스팅 서비스 선택
먼저 웹사이트를 운영할 호스팅 서비스를 선택하세요. 국내에서는 아래와 같은 호스팅 서비스가 유명합니다.
- 카페24
- 가비아
- AWS (Amazon Web Services)
- 나무호스팅
- 호스트웨이
각 호스팅 서비스는 도메인 연결 기능을 지원하며, 연결 방법에 대한 문서를 제공합니다.
도메인 구매
도메인이 없다면 도메인 등록 서비스에서 도메인을 구매해야 합니다. 추천 서비스는 다음과 같아요:
- 가비아
- 닷네임코리아
- Namecheap (글로벌)
- GoDaddy (글로벌)
구매 시 짧고 간결하며, 브랜드와 잘 어울리는 도메인을 선택하세요.
필수 정보 확인
도메인 연결을 위해 호스팅 서비스에서 아래 정보를 확인해야 합니다.
- 네임서버(NS) 주소: 도메인을 연결할 때 사용하는 서버 주소
- IP 주소: 일부 호스팅 서비스는 IP 주소를 제공하여 직접 연결하도록 합니다.
3. 도메인과 호스팅 연결하기
도메인과 웹호스팅을 연결하는 과정은 아래와 같습니다.
3.1 네임서버 설정 변경
도메인 등록 서비스에서 네임서버를 변경하여 도메인을 웹호스팅에 연결할 수 있어요.
- 도메인 등록 서비스 로그인:
- 가비아, 닷네임코리아 등에서 구매한 도메인의 관리 페이지에 접속하세요.
- 네임서버 변경 메뉴:
도메인 설정 > 네임서버 관리메뉴로 이동합니다.
- 웹호스팅 네임서버 정보 입력:
- 호스팅 서비스 제공자가 제공한 네임서버 정보를 입력하세요.
- 예:
ns1.hostingexample.comns2.hostingexample.com
- 예:
- 호스팅 서비스 제공자가 제공한 네임서버 정보를 입력하세요.
- 저장 후 확인:
- 변경 사항을 저장하고, 적용 여부를 확인하세요.
변경 후 적용되기까지 보통 24시간에서 48시간 정도 걸릴 수 있습니다.
3.2 DNS 레코드 설정
네임서버를 변경하지 않고도 DNS 레코드를 수정하여 연결할 수 있습니다.
- 도메인 관리 페이지 접속:
DNS 관리메뉴를 선택합니다.
- A 레코드 수정:
- A 레코드를 선택하고, 호스팅 서비스에서 제공한 IP 주소를 입력하세요.
- CNAME 레코드 추가:
- 필요 시 서브도메인에 대해 CNAME 레코드를 설정합니다.
4. 연결 후 확인하기
도메인과 호스팅을 연결한 뒤, 정상적으로 작동하는지 확인해야 합니다.
방법 1: 웹브라우저에서 도메인 입력
브라우저에 도메인을 입력하여 웹사이트가 정상적으로 표시되는지 확인하세요.
방법 2: DNS Propagation Tool 사용
DNS Propagation Tool을 사용하면 도메인이 전 세계적으로 잘 연결되었는지 확인할 수 있습니다.
방법 3: Ping 테스트
터미널이나 명령 프롬프트에서 ping 도메인명 명령어를 입력하여 서버 응답을 확인하세요.
추가 정보: 네임서버와 DNS의 차이
네임서버란?
네임서버는 도메인의 트래픽을 어디로 보낼지 알려주는 서버입니다. 웹호스팅 서비스에서 네임서버를 제공하며, 이를 통해 도메인과 연결됩니다.
DNS란?
DNS(Domain Name System)는 사용자가 입력한 도메인을 IP 주소로 변환하는 시스템이에요. 이 과정을 통해 도메인과 서버가 연결됩니다.
| 용어 | 설명 |
|---|---|
| 네임서버(NS) | 도메인의 트래픽을 연결하는 서버 주소 |
| A 레코드 | 도메인을 특정 IP 주소로 연결하는 기록 |
| CNAME | 서브도메인을 다른 도메인으로 연결 |
결론
도메인과 웹호스팅 연결은 웹사이트 운영의 첫 단계로, 도메인의 네임서버를 변경하거나 DNS 레코드를 수정하는 방식으로 설정할 수 있습니다. 처음에는 조금 복잡해 보일 수 있지만, 차근차근 따라 하면 어렵지 않아요. 도메인을 연결한 뒤에는 정상적으로 작동하는지 반드시 확인하고, 필요하면 호스팅 서비스 고객센터의 도움을 받으세요.
FAQ
1. 네임서버 변경 후 적용 시간은 얼마나 걸리나요?
보통 24~48시간이 소요되며, 인터넷 서비스 제공업체(ISP)에 따라 차이가 있을 수 있습니다.
2. 도메인을 여러 호스팅에 연결할 수 있나요?
기본적으로 도메인은 하나의 네임서버만 지정할 수 있습니다. 하지만 하위 도메인을 사용하면 여러 호스팅으로 분리할 수 있습니다.
3. 네임서버 변경이 아닌 DNS 설정만으로 연결 가능한가요?
네, 가능합니다. 도메인의 A 레코드나 CNAME 레코드를 수정하여 연결할 수 있습니다.
4. 무료 호스팅에서도 도메인 연결이 가능한가요?
대부분의 무료 호스팅 서비스도 도메인 연결을 지원하지만, 일부 기능은 제한될 수 있습니다.
5. 네임서버와 DNS 설정 중 어느 것이 더 좋나요?
네임서버 변경은 일반적인 방법이고, DNS 설정은 세부적인 제어가 필요할 때 사용됩니다. 상황에 맞게 선택하세요.
